本文将分享如何打造自己的乐亭H5小程序,针对高级开发者进行教程分享。文章分为5个大段落,分别介绍H5小程序的概念、开发环境的搭建、页面搭建及组件使用、数据绑定和事件处理以及小程序优化和发布。帮助读者深入了解H5小程序的开发流程及技巧,从而打造出高品质的小程序。
1. 了解H5小程序
H5小程序是一种轻量级的应用,类似于微信小程序,但是不需要在特定平台上运行。它可以运行在多个平台上,如微信、支付宝、百度等,并通过浏览器访问。开发者可以通过HTML、CSS和JavaScript等技术来构建页面,同时H5小程序也支持使用外部库和框架进行开发。而H5小程序与传统的HTML页面不同的地方在于,它可以进行本地存储和调用设备硬件等功能,使得用户可以获得更高质量的应用体验。
2. 搭建开发环境
搭建H5小程序的开发环境需要准备好开发工具和必要的插件库。目前市面上常用的开发工具有Sublime Text、VSCode和WebStorm,我们可以根据个人需求选择适合自己的工具。同时还需要安装一些常用的插件,如微信开发者工具、npm、vue和React等库。这些插件的作用是使开发者能够更快速的开发小程序,提高开发效率和质量。搭建好开发环境后,就可以开始设计和编写自己的页面和组件。
3. 页面搭建及组件使用
H5小程序的页面搭建方式与传统的HTML页面类似,使用HTML语言来定义页面的结构和布局,CSS语言来定义页面的样式和效果。同时还需要使用JavaScript来为页面添加交互和动态效果,常见的动态效果如列表渲染和条件渲染等。在搭建页面的过程中,可以使用常用的组件库,如VantUI和WeUI等库,这些组件库都包含了常用的组件样式和组件的交互效果,可以大大提高开发的效率和质量。
4. 数据绑定和事件处理
在H5小程序中,数据绑定非常重要,可以让页面展示出动态效果。数据绑定可以通过Vue.js和React等库来实现,这些库都具有优秀的数据绑定和组件化能力。同时,在H5小程序中,事件处理也非常重要,通过事件绑定可以实现组件的交互效果和页面的动态效果。常见的事件有tap、longpress和scroll等,可以通过JavaScript来实现。
5. 小程序优化和发布
为了让自己的小程序更加优秀,需要对小程序进行优化和发布。优化方面可以通过减少文件的大小和提高代码的效率来实现,包括压缩和拆分文件、使用懒加载和延迟加载等技巧。发布方面需要按照相关的规定进行发布,在提交审核前需要检查小程序是否符合发布要求,并进行一些必要的调整。发布成功后,可以通过各大平台进行推广和营销,提高小程序的曝光率和用户体验。
通过本文的介绍,读者可以了解H5小程序的概念和使用方法,了解H5小程序开发的基本步骤和技巧。同时,也可以通过本文提供的教程和资料构建自己的乐亭H5小程序,并发挥创意,打造出独具特色的小程序。希望读者可以从中受益,并在开发中获得更丰富的经验。
随着H5技术的发展,越来越多的企业开始将自己的业务移植到小程序上。对于小程序开发者来说,掌握一定的技巧和知识,打造自己的小程序是必不可少的。本文将从乐亭H5小程序的高级功能和技巧入手,分享一些实用的开发技巧和经验。
1.优化小程序性能,提高用户体验
在开发小程序的过程中,我们不仅需要考虑小程序的功能和界面设计,还需要考虑小程序性能对用户体验的影响。在处理一些复杂的数据时,如果不进行合理的优化,很容易导致小程序卡顿、运行缓慢等问题。
2. 引入公用模块,提高开发效率
除了进行性能优化,提高开发效率也是我们在开发小程序时需要考虑的问题。在开发过程中,我们可以将一些公用的模块和组件提取出来,通过NPM包的方式进行引入。这样既能提高开发效率,又能减少代码冗余,使得小程序更加轻量化。
3. 掌握小程序自定义组件的使用
小程序自定义组件是小程序开发中不可或缺的一部分。通过自定义组件,我们可以方便地重用业务逻辑和界面代码。除此之外,自定义组件还能提高代码的可读性、减少代码冗余,让小程序更加优雅。
4. 发布小程序,达到更好的推广效果
当我们的小程序开发工作全部完成之后,就需要进行小程序发布了。为了达到更好的推广效果,我们可以考虑采取多种方式来进行宣传和推广,比如通过社交网络、微博博主的推荐、口碑传播等方式来让更多的人知道我们的小程序。
5. 持续更新和迭代小程序,增加用户粘性
发布小程序仅仅是第一步。对于追求卓越的小程序开发者来说,持续更新和迭代小程序是提高用户粘性的关键。通过持续迭代,我们可以改善已存在的功能、增加新的功能或完善用户界面,达到更好的用户体验。
本文主要是从乐亭H5小程序的高级功能和技巧入手,分享了一些实用的开发技巧和经验。无论是优化小程序性能,还是引入公用模块,掌握自定义组件的使用,都可以提高我们的开发效率和小程序的质量。同时,通过采取多种方式来进行宣传和推广,并持续迭代小程序,都非常有利于增加用户的粘性。希望本文对小程序开发者们能有所帮助。